Job info

IR RN

Overview

  • Specialty: IR RN
  • Location: Bismarck, North Dakota
  • Contract length: 13 weeks
  • Shift: Days
  • Hours per week: 40
  • Department: IR (RN)
  • Unit details: 2 labs

Required Qualifications

  • RN license
  • BLS certification
  • ACLS certification
  • Moderate sedation experience
  • Experience managing conscious sedation in IR
  • Experience charting, circulating, and doing pre- and post-procedure care for IR
  • Radiation badge must be supplied and in hand prior to start

Preferred

  • NIHSS

Clinical Details

  • Average volume: 5-10 cases per day
  • Common patient types and procedures: inpatient, outpatient, and emergent cases; Stroke Thrombectomy; Embolizations; Lines; Tubes; Visceral; Para; Thora; Biopsies; drain insertions; chest tubes; CT and US areas
  • IR techs are available
  • Interventionalist coverage: Intensivitst MD in house 24/7; IR always available; on call after hours

Scheduling and Call

  • Shift options: 2x10-hour shifts, 2x8-hour shifts, or all 8s
  • Shift times: 0700-1530 and 0600-1630
  • Scheduling: team scheduling, posted 17 days prior for 6 weeks at a time
  • Weeknight call: 1-2 days per week
  • Weekend call: every third weekend
  • Holiday call: every other holiday
  • Call response time: 30 minutes

Float Scope

  • Radiology pre/post

Additional Notes

  • Prescreen + auto offer
  • RTO: 7 days or less upfront for the 13-week contract; additional RTO will not be approved
  • Orientation: one week of classroom and lab
  • Scrub color/dress code provided
  • Team lead is present in the lab; supervisor and lead sign time cards
  • Bring your own lock for the locker and hospital-designated shoes

About Bismarck, ND

As a Travel Interventional Radiology Nurse in Bismarck, ND here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• Bismarck's cost of living is slightly l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
  •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living.
Weather
  • Average summer highs are around 83°F, and winter lows can drop to around 5°F, so be prepared for a wide range of temperatures throughout the year.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als are available in Bismarck, and they are relatively easy to find due to the city's size and demand for temporary housing.
Transportation
  • Bismarck is car-friendly with easy access to parking.
  • Public transportation options are limited, so having a car is essential for getting around.
Demographics
  • Bismarck has a fairly homogenous population with a majority of residents being of European descent.
  • The age range is diverse, with a significant portion of the population being middle-aged.
  • Common health issues may include seasonal affective disorder due to the long, cold winters.
  • There is a growing population of travel nurses in Bismarck due to the demand for healthcare professionals in the area.
Things to Do
  • Bismarck offers a variety of restaurants, cultural attractions, and outdoor activities.
  • You can explore historical sites like Fort Abraham Lincoln, enjoy dinner cruises on the Lewis and Clark Riverboat, and visit the North Dakota State Capitol for stunning views.
  • The city also has a range of dining and entertainment options, as well as riverfront trails for outdoor enthusiasts.
